Discover and Select an Uninitialized Storage Center
The rst page of the Discover and Congure Uninitialized Storage Centers wizard provides a list of prerequisite actions and
information required before setting up a
Storage Center.
Prerequisites
The host server, on which the Storage Manager software is installed, must be on the same subnet or VLAN as the Storage
Center.
Temporarily disable any rewall on the host server that is running the Storage Manager.
Layer 2 multicast must be allowed on the network.
Make sure that IGMP snooping is disabled on the switch ports connected to the Storage Center.
Steps
1. Make sure that you have the required information that is listed on the rst page of the wizard. This information is needed to
congure the Storage Center.
2. Click Next. The Select a Storage Center to Initialize page appears and lists the uninitialized Storage Centers discovered by the
wizard.
NOTE: If the wizard does not discover the Storage Center that you want to initialize, perform one of the following
actions:
Make sure that the Storage Center hardware is physically attached to all necessary networks.
Click Rediscover.
Click Troubleshoot Storage Center Hardware Issue to learn more about reasons why the Storage Center is not
discoverable.
Follow the steps in Deploy the Storage Center Using the Direct Connect Method.
3. Select the Storage Center to initialize.
4. (Optional) Click Enable Storage Center Indicator to turn on the indicator light for the selected Storage Center. You can use the
indicator to verify that you have selected the correct
Storage Center.
5. Click Next.
6. If the Storage Center is partially congured, the Storage Center login pane appears. Enter the management IPv4 address and
the Admin password for the Storage Center, then click Next to continue.
Set System Information
The Set System Information page allows you to enter Storage Center and storage controller conguration information to use when
connecting to the
Storage Center using Storage Manager.
1. Type a descriptive name for the Storage Center in the Storage Center Name eld.
2. Type the system management IPv4 address for the Storage Center in the Virtual Management IPv4 Address eld.
The management IPv4 address is the IP address used to manage the Storage Center and is dierent from a storage controller
IPv4 address.
3. Type an IPv4 address for the management port of each storage controller.
NOTE: The storage controller IPv4 addresses and management IPv4 address must be within the same subnet.
4. Type the subnet mask of the management network in the Subnet Mask eld.
5. Type the gateway address of the management network in the Gateway IPv4 Address eld.
6. Type the domain name of the management network in the Domain Name eld.
7. Type the DNS server addresses of the management network in the DNS Server and Secondary DNS Server elds.
8. Click Next.
